QR and Barcode

Generate linear and matrix codes for any text or URL.

The QR and Barcode generation feature allows you to encode any text string or URL as a barcode or a QR code and insert it as a graphical object in a document for scanning.

To access this command...

Choose Insert - OLE Object - QR and Barcode.

URL or text

The text from which to generate the code.

Error correction

The error correction value for the QR Code that is to be created. The error correction of a QR code is a measure that helps a QR code to recover if it is damaged.

There are four standard error correction values.

  • Low: 7% of codewords can be restored.
  • Medium: 15% of codewords can be restored.
  • Quartile: 25% of codewords can be restored.
  • High: 30% of codewords can be restored.

Margin

The width of the margin surrounding the code.
